Hello Alan, just a quick tip on the difference between a "pocket" and a sleeve: a sleeve will allow your batten to enter at one end and exit at the other. A pocket with allow your batten to enter at one end, then stop at the other (just like your change pocket in your blue jeans. Haha!) Not really. It would mean some holes in the batten pockets, but that wouldn't affect the sailing ability, or the integrity of the sail. You'd need to chafe through most of the length of the batten pocket to cause a problem, which would be that the sail could pull away from the battens when on starboard tack - but it's hard to see that happening. Still a good call to make good and fit the carpet - it will make for a quieter time in light conditions. And preserve the paintwork on the mast.
